1. A golf ball comprising:

  • an inner core layer formed from a first thermoset composition and having a diameter of from 0.50 inches to 1.30 inches;

    an intermediate core layer formed from a thermoplastic composition and comprising a plurality of projections disposed on the outer surface thereof;

    an outer core layer formed from a second thermoset composition; and

    a cover;

    wherein the outer surface hardness of the intermediate core layer is greater than the outer surface hardness of the outer core layer; and

    wherein the inner core layer has a center hardness of 80 Shore C or less and an outer surface hardness of 30 Shore C or greater;

    the outer core layer has an outer surface hardness of 25 Shore C or greater;

    the outer surface hardness of the inner core layer is greater than the center hardness; and

    the difference between the outer surface Shore C hardness of the outer core layer and the center Shore C hardness is from 0 to 40.
